Miguel Peropadre (1946–1983) was a Spanish bullfighter who brought skill, courage, and artistry to the traditional spectacle of bullfighting. His career, though tragically brief, demonstrated the dedication and bravery required of those who pursue this demanding profession.
Peropadre's life in the arena reflected the passion and commitment characteristic of Spanish bullfighting tradition. He was laid to rest at Torrero Cemetery, where he is remembered as a practitioner of one of Spain's most iconic cultural traditions.
